WebJan 10, 2024 · Right-click the speaker icon on the Windows taskbar and then select Sound settings. You can also access this through the Windows 11 Settings app. A window will open. Look for the Input section and examine the list of input microphones available. Check that the microphone you want to use is selected. If not, select it. WebNov 17, 2024 · First of all, open Windows 11 search and type in ‘Sound Settings’. Open Sound Settings from the list of options. On the Sound Settings page, select the speaker or headphone you are using. Next, click on the Arrow button behind the playback device. Under the General option, you need to click on the Allow option.

Wait for the Windows Explorer to start and show up again. Now check if you can use the volume controller. WebDec 3, 2024 · Click on Sound. Under the Playback tab, right-click on the empty area and make sure “Show Disabled Devices” has a checkmark on it. If your headphones/Speakers are disabled, they will now show up in the list. Right-click on the device and Enable it. Follow the same procedure to Disable the enabled devices. 5.
